TMK has planted more than 40 thousand seedlings in the regions of its presence as part of a corporate eco-campaign.

The Pipe Metallurgical Company (TMK) held an action "TMK Green Initiative", aimed at greening territories and restoring forests in the regions of its presence. In the Volgograd, Rostov, Sverdlovsk and Chelyabinsk regions, as well as in Moscow, the company's employees planted more than 40 thousand trees and shrubs. The project was operated by the All-Russian public movement "Volunteers of the Forest".

Employees of the Volga Pipe Plant (VTZ), with the participation of TMK employees and the veterans Council of the enterprise, planted acacias on the territory of the Sredneakhtubinsky forestry district of the Volgograd region, linden trees and pines on green areas near the factory workshops. In total, more than 5,000 seedlings were planted by the Volga residents as part of the campaign. About 120 seedlings of coniferous shrubs, junipers and pines have landscaped the territory of the Taganrog Metallurgical Plant (Tagmet), the adjacent Dzerzhinsky Street and the entrance alley of the Taganrog Technical College of Mechanical Engineering and Metallurgy "Tagmet". An alley of weeping willows also appeared on the Chekhov Embankment of Taganrog.

In the territory of the Sysert forestry of the Sverdlovsk region, employees of Pervouralsky Novotrubny (PNTZ), Seversky (STZ) and Sinarsky (SinTZ) pipe plants planted more than 30 thousand pines. Also in Pervouralsk, PNTZ employees planted 29 lime saplings on one of the central streets, and 20 fir trees on the territory of the enterprise. Factory workers planted 35 trees on the territory of Polevskoye on the occasion of the 100th anniversary of the primary trade union organization.

5,000 pine seedlings were replaced at the site of a burnt forest in the Chelyabinsk region with the assistance of employees of the Chelyabinsk Pipe Rolling Plant (ChelPipe) with the participation of TMK employees, representatives of the volunteer movement and the veterans Council of the enterprise. The alley planted last year with 20 seedlings of small-leaved linden was continued on the territory of the enterprise itself.

Employees of the company's Moscow office also took part in the campaign, planting together with the "Forest Volunteers" about 30 bushes of spiraea, willow, rowan and barberry in the green areas near the Scientific and Technical Center (STC) TMK.

"TMK, as a socially responsible company, strives for the integrated development of the regions where it operates, including the conservation of environmental biodiversity and the maintenance of a favorable environmental environment. In addition to restoring forests and landscaping, the company's enterprises replenish aquatic biological resources, minimize emissions into the atmosphere, reduce volumes, sort and recycle waste, and implement other environmental protection measures," said Marianna Klimova, TMK's chief ecologist.
